About United Arab Emirates

The UAE is the the Middle East's most dynamic destination, with some of the world's most luxurious and stunning hotels, high-profile shopping and sports, spectacular landscapes and fine beaches.  The country offers a unique living culture, with glittering gold souks, old-fashioned dhow harbours, romantic desert forts, camel racing and desert safaris.   While Dubai has made tourism running with high profile developments such as the palms project, Abu Dhabi is jousting for bigger share of the UAE tourism market too and there is a lot of development activity now taking place in Abu Dhabi.

Grand Mosque, Abu Dhabi, United Arab Emirates
Abu Dhabi has evolved from the little-known desert kingdom into one of the world's most dynamic visitor destinations.   Luxury hotels glint in the sun, boats bob in the warm Gulf and the heady feel of authentic Arabia underlies it all.   It has always been a place apart, backed by spectacular dunes, fanned by tropical breezes and upheld by a rich heritage.   Today's Abu Dhabi is a mix of age-old culture and modern comforts, somewhere where indulgence and relaxation go hand in hand with adventure.   Its future is well shaped too: take as examples the Formula 1 Grand Prix, coming to Abu Dhabi from 2009; the under construction Guggenheim Museum and the recently announced Louvre Abu Dhabi.
Burj Al Arab, Dubai, United Arab Emirates

Dubai is less than eight hours from Europe.  Initially a small fishing settlement, Dubai is the 'gateway between East and West.   The city, one of seven Emirates making up the United Arab Emirates, infuses tradition and heritage with modernity and style.  Rapidly developing as an international leisure and retail centre, Dubai, presents a wide variety of attractions for the visitor.  Dubai offers a wide variety of attractions including stunning beaches, five-star service, legendary hotels, vibrant shopping and gleaming skyscrapers on one side, traditional souqs and old trading dhows on the other hand.   Tourist can experience everything from large state-of-the-art leisure and retail malls, historic landmarks, rugged mountains and awesome dunes to sandy beaches, turquoise waters, lush green parks and the enduring tranquility of the desert.  It is one of the fastest growing cities in the region and the world.  With the Burj Dubai at its bustling epicentre and unprecedented developments such as The Palm, The World, Dubailand and Dubai Waterfront, this city-for-the-future delivers a fabulous cosmopolitan lifestyle amid understated elegance.  The city also plays host to numerous sporting events, rugby, golf, horse racing and tennis to name a few and also frequent cultural and shopping festivals.  The ideal weather and superb facilities make Dubai the perfect destination for those wanting an action packed and exciting holiday.

Key information

Time difference
GMT + 4 hours
UK flight time
7 hours 5 minutes
Local currency
Dirham
Peak season
November to April
